Definition and Explanation

Secured creditor rights refer to a lender’s lawful authority to seize or liquidate collateral when a borrower defaults, under applicable law and contract terms.

Key Elements and Processes

Key elements include valid security agreements, perfection of liens, notices to debtors, and orderly collection steps.

Glossary of Key Terms

This glossary defines terms commonly used in secured collection matters in California.

Security Interest

A security interest is a lender’s legal right in collateral that secures repayment of a debt.

Lien

A lien is a legal claim against property that secures payment or performance.

Default

Default occurs when a borrower fails to meet payment or other obligations under the loan.

Perfection

Perfection is the process of establishing priority in the collateral against other creditors.
